From day 2 of the 1985 horizontal, 24-25 Jan 2015, Holiday Inn Issaquah. All Ports were tasted blind. Unless otherwise noted, Ports were decanted for ~4 hours the morning of the tasting. The ones that I decanted received ~8 hours of decant overnight and were then stoppered for another ~6 hours until the tasting.

1985 Quarles Harris Vintage Port

Color: Medium red/tawny, some yellow-orange in the rim. Starting to show its age.

Nose: Fig, light prune, some light caramel.

Palate: Light and fairly thin. Some oak? Maybe some butter? Pretty strange palate... seems very oxidized, but not in any way I've encountered before.

Score: 84 points. While pleasant, this was a very strange vintage Port. I kept waffling between a bad seal and heat damage, but ultimately couldn't really say for certain that either had occurred even though the Port seems very prematurely aged. Possibly should have been N/R, but I left it as scored.
